Condensation and fog

When moisture forms between the window panes, it's a clear indication the seal on your insulated glass unit (IGU) has failed. The windows won't be as effective in keeping heat in during winter and cool outdoors in summer. The good part is that it's typically possible to fix the issue without having to replace the entire window.

The majority of modern Double glazed Windows Handles- and triple-pane windows are made of insulated glass units (IGUs). They are made up of two or more panes of glass that are held together by gaskets made of rubber and inert gases like argon and Krypton. Over time the gases become less effective, which allows moisture to get inside the glass and result in condensation.

Windows that are stained by fog are a frequent problem, especially in humid areas where temperature fluctuations can cause the gasket to break down and allow moisture in. If left unchecked, this could lead to a major reduction in energy efficiency and eventually damage the wooden frames and glass of your windows.

Poor Insulation

Today's double-pane windows are often coated with argon gas to prevent heat loss. This non-toxic, odorless gas reduces energy transfer and helps keep your home warmer during winter and cooler during summer. It's also one of the most advanced features of modern windows, and can improve your home's efficiency by reducing energy costs. If you've noticed that your window has lost a significant amount of gas argon an expert in window repair can make use of a specific instrument to replace it.

If the seal on a double-paned windows fails, cold or hot air can pass through the two panes of glass. This reduces the insulation of your window and can cause unnecessary stress to your home's heating or cooling system. This is a problem that needs to be addressed as quickly as you can, since it could cause higher energy bills and more costly repairs.
